You might want to experiment with electric razors and different brands of non-electric ones. If you're going have a picture taken, shave just before. For a special occasion, you can see a barber for a straight-razor shave.If you don't mind the discomfort and cost, you can have your facial hair permanently removed through electrolysis or laser hair removal, to permanently get rid of the hair. Otherwise, learn to live with it. I'm sure some people would consider it a fine male trait.
